My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Willow is the kind of dog that makes you
believe in second chances. At 7 years old, this gentle girl has already shown she’s a devoted companion — fantastic with people and children as young as 3, soft and wiggly when you approach her kennel, and quick to roll over for love.

She came to the shelter after her Texas rescue placement didn’t work out because the resident dog wouldn’t accept her. Through it all, Willow has remained sweet and resilient. She’s housetrained for the most part, knows “sit” and “down,” and adores chew toys.

💛 Gentle and affectionate — especially with children
💛 Friendly, wiggly, and loves human attention
💛 Loves toys and being by your side

Additional adoption info

We offer a foster to adopt program to ensure the dog is the right fit for your home.
Dog introductions are required with any dog in the home.

Our dogs are placed in foster homes or in boarding facilities around the Phoenix area. We have adoption events at various locations throughout the area and information is posted on our facebook page about upcoming events.

More about this rescue

Freedom Brothers rescue is a 501c3 organization founded in 2013 to help find homeless pets their furever homes. We are an all breed rescue and find loving homes for puppies, adults and seniors so that they may live their lives knowing love and companionship.
